An outboard motor is a vital component of any boat, providing power and propulsion for smooth sailing. To ensure longevity, efficiency, and safety, regular maintenance is essential. Whether you’re a seasoned boater or a weekend enthusiast, proper care of your outboard motor will save you from costly repairs and breakdowns.   1. Regularly Flush the Engine After every outing, particularly in saltwater, it is crucial to flush the engine with fresh water. Salt, debris, and contaminants can build up in the cooling system, leading to corrosion and blockages. Use a flushing attachment or muffs to run fresh water through the engine for at least 10-15 minutes. This simple habit will help prolong the life of your motor.
  2. Check and Change the Engine Oil Just like a car engine, an outboard motor requires clean oil for smooth operation. Check the oil level regularly and change it according to the manufacturer’s recommendations. Old or dirty oil can cause increased friction, overheating, and wear. Using the correct grade of marine engine oil ensures optimal performance and protection.
  3. Inspect and Replace Spark Plugs Spark plugs play a key role in the ignition system, and worn-out plugs can lead to poor performance, rough idling, and difficulty starting the engine. Inspect your spark plugs for corrosion and wear, and replace them as needed. A fresh set of spark plugs can improve fuel efficiency and engine response.
  4. Maintain the Fuel System Fuel contamination is a common issue that can lead to engine failure. Use fresh fuel and consider adding a fuel stabilizer to prevent ethanol-related damage. Regularly inspect the fuel lines, primer bulb, and connectors for cracks or leaks. Replace the fuel filter as part of routine maintenance to prevent clogging and ensure a steady fuel supply.
  5. Keep the Propeller in Top Condition The propeller is a critical part of your outboard motor’s performance. Inspect it for dings, cracks, or bent blades, as these can affect efficiency and cause vibrations. Remove fishing line or debris wrapped around the propeller shaft, and ensure the propeller nut is secure. If needed, have a professional balance and sharpen the blades.
  6. Monitor the Cooling System The cooling system prevents overheating, so it’s essential to check the water pump and impeller regularly. If you notice weak water flow or an overheating engine, it may be time to replace the impeller. Inspect the cooling hoses for blockages and ensure the water intake is clear of debris.
  7. Store Your Outboard Motor Properly Proper storage is crucial, especially during the off-season. Store your boat in a dry, covered area, and tilt the motor downward to drain any remaining water. Fogging the engine with a corrosion inhibitor protects internal components from rust. Additionally, remove the battery and store it in a cool, dry place.
  8. Perform Routine Inspections and Tune-Ups A comprehensive inspection before every trip can prevent unexpected issues. Check for loose bolts, worn belts, and electrical connections. Ensure the steering system operates smoothly, and test the trim and tilt functions. Scheduling professional tune-ups ensures your motor stays in peak condition.
